Transaction 49737d72387ca7274ba023719f40318b4601a1f0e6d18bc4b4a101e4e22a45bc

1 Input
1 Outputs
  • 49737d72387ca7274ba023719f40318b4601a1f0e6d18bc4b4a101e4e22a45bc:0
  • value  51066876
    address  12DUYQHGsAcVtS2eUHka2WSTsWdFSW1P8M